They are plans that are drawn in conjunction with a subdivision plan. It denotes how upcoming construction activities will affect the movement of stormwater and sediment across a construction site and onto abutting properties. It also depicts how developers will adjust grading activities to limit the depositing of more stormwater and sediment onto abutting properties than was done prior to the construction.

Types of Sediment Control

Sediment control is the practice or device that is designed to keep eroded soil on a construction site. As part of this plan, the goal is to see that the soil does not wash off or cause water pollution to streams, rivers, lakes or seas nearby. Commonly used sediments controls are:

  • dams

  • dikes

  • fiber rolls

  • sandbag barriers

 

These control types are typically employed with erosion controls and are usually only temporary measures. However, some control plans can be used for stormwater management purposes and perhaps see a longer lifespan.

Erosion Control

Erosion control is the prevention or controlling of wind or water erosion in agriculture, land development, coastal areas, river banks or construction sites. Effective erosion control plans are important in the prevention of water pollution, soil loss and wildlife habitat loss.
